|
CATIA V5 Programmierung : KWA Reihenfolge der Berechnung eines Updates
moppesle am 08.04.2013 um 10:18 Uhr (0)
Hallo Wolfgang,du kannst in eine Rule auch eine oder mehrere Message bei Fallunterscheidung einbringen wenn dir das weiterhelfen sollte.------------------Gruß UweAuch Catia ist nur ein Mensch!
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catpart umbenennen nach txt File
Kay Petri am 09.04.2013 um 11:38 Uhr (0)
Ok Ich habe es dann doch hinbekommen.Code:Dim oPrtdoc As PartDocumentDim prtname As StringPublic Sub getprismanumber()Dim iFile As IntegeriFile = FreeFileDim sFile As String, sTemp() As StringReDim sTemp(0)sFile = "C: mpfiles.txt"Open sFile For Input As #iFile Do While Not EOF(iFile) ReDim sTemp(UBound(sTemp) + 0) Line Input #iFile, sTemp(UBound(sTemp)) LoopClose #iFileFor iFile = LBound(sTemp()) To UBound(sTemp())MsgBox sTemp(iFile) abfrage txtzeileprtname = sTemp(iFile)Next iFileSet oPrtdoc = CATIA.Act 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Punkte auf Linie erzeugen und beibehalten
maetz26 am 08.04.2013 um 10:34 Uhr (0)
Hallo,danke für die Begrüßung und Beantwortung meiner Frage!Ja, ich würde die Punkte gerne per Makro erzeugen - habe allerdings kein Vorwissen im Programmieren und die Bücher "Kochbuch CATIA automatisieren" und "CATIA V5 Makroprogrammierung mit Visual Basic Script" helfen mir leider auch nicht wirklich weiter Ich hoffe, ich bekomme noch mehr Hilfe von euch!?[Diese Nachricht wurde von maetz26 am 09. Apr. 2013 editiert.]
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: KWA Reihenfolge der Berechnung eines Updates
moppesle am 08.04.2013 um 10:41 Uhr (0)
Hallo Wolfgang,Zitat:Aber die Meldung kommt auch so. Dann hast du definitiv einen Zirkelverweis drin.------------------Gruß UweAuch Catia ist nur ein Mensch!
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: KWA Reihenfolge der Berechnung eines Updates
Wolfgang B. aus K. am 08.04.2013 um 10:56 Uhr (0)
Hallo Uwe,meinst Du ich habe einen Update cycle? Dann würde Catia mir das doch gleich melden.Oder was meinst du mit einem Zirkelverweis?GrußWolfgang
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: KWA Reihenfolge der Berechnung eines Updates
moppesle am 08.04.2013 um 11:13 Uhr (0)
Hallo Wolfgang,Zitat:meinst Du ich habe einen Update cycle? Dann würde Catia mir das doch gleich melden.Oder was meinst du mit einem Zirkelverweis?Vom Prinzip ist es ein Update Cycle aber in den Relations. Kannst du mal den Code posten?------------------Gruß UweAuch Catia ist nur ein Mensch!
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: KWA Reihenfolge der Berechnung eines Updates
moppesle am 08.04.2013 um 13:00 Uhr (0)
Hi Wolfgang,Du erzeugst eine Situation in der Beide Fälle zutreffen können.Das erklärt auch die Meldung. Erste Abfrage trift zu, dann "AdapterGuidingCheck = true" bedeutet: Ausgabe der Message Zeite Abfrage trift auch zu, dann "AdapterGuidingCheck = false" bedeutet: Ckeck wird deaktiviert.------------------Gruß UweAuch Catia ist nur ein Mensch!
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: KWA Reihenfolge der Berechnung eines Updates
Wolfgang B. aus K. am 05.04.2013 um 14:40 Uhr (0)
Hallo zusammen,ich probiers mal in diesem Forum.Hat jemand von Euch eine Idee in welcher Reihenfolge Rules, Reactions, Checks und Formeln von Catia abgearbeitet werden.Ich habe hier einen Fall. In der Rule wird die Activity der drei unteren Checks kontrolliert. Der untere Check wird beim Update deaktiviert, aber ich bekomme die Meldung aus diesem Check nach dem Update. Anscheinend haut er die Meldung noch raus bevor der Check deaktiv ist. Siehe BildKann mir hier jemand helfen? Was kann ich tun?Danke für Eu 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Reframe on bei einer Zeichnung
Philipp61285 am 09.04.2013 um 09:22 Uhr (0)
Hallo zusammen,erst mal danke an alle, ich nutze dieses Forum schon ziemlich lange und es hat mir schon oft geholfen. Leider reichte die Suchfunktion bei meinem aktuellen Problem nicht aus.Kurze Makrobeschreibung:Ich schreibe gerade ein Makro mit VBA um Positionsangaben in einer Zeichnung zu erstellen. Des weiteren kann diese Makro auch eine Auswertung fahren,welche Position der Stückliste in der Zeichnung wo positioniert ist. Es öffnet sich eine Userform mit einer Listbox, in der die Stückliste enhalten i 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ia v5 automatisieren
bgrittmann am 28.05.2013 um 17:05 Uhr (1)
ServusGemäß einer Erfahrung: bei VB6 kann man den Code komplett übernehmen (kleiner Modifikationen sind nötig), bei VB.net sind größer Modifikationen notwendig (manche Methode in VB haben sich geändert)GrußBernd------------------Warum einfach, wenn es auch kompliziert geht.
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Makros mit Vb .Net
adrian83 am 09.04.2013 um 17:53 Uhr (0)
ja,das ist ein wertvoller tip. aber mir kommt es so vor, dass slebst dort nicht alle objekte drin sind. wie kommt man an den rest dran?-------------------Windows 7 64 bit-Catia V5 r19
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Catia v5 automatisieren
adrian83 am 28.05.2013 um 16:58 Uhr (1)
Hallo!also,ich habe nun einiges per VBA automatisieren können,bin dort aber an Grenzen gestoßen,hauptsächlich weil die Api dort nicht alles zur Verfügung steht.Um auf die Antwort von R.Schulz zurückzukommen, möchte ich nun den Rest mit "echtem" Visual Basic erledigen. Ich möchte nämlich so mit einem Programm sowohl Windows-API,als auch Catia-API ansprechen um eben Mausklicks usw. auch noch zu automatisieren.Welches VB ist in diesem Falle das einfachste? Wie müssen meine laufenden CatVBA-Makros abgeändert w ...
|
In das Form CATIA V5 Programmierung wechseln |
|
CATIA V5 Programmierung : Fehlermeldung beim Aufrufen eines Makros (.catvba)
Christian.O am 05.11.2010 um 10:39 Uhr (0)
Servus,das haben wir bei uns in der Firma auch auf einem Rechner.Wie die Meldung schon sagt lassen wir dann immer den RegServer von Catia laufen und dann gehts wieder (bis zum nächsten Neustart)Zum Regserver ausführen: Start (Windows) - Ausführen - cmd eintippen - im nächsten Fenster den Pfad zur cnext.exe eingeben (Bsp: C:appsDSBMWB19x64win_b64codein) - cnext.exe regserver eingeben. Was da genau passiert weiß ich nicht. Anscheinend wird Catia in die Registry neu eingetragen/registriert. Das kann dir aber ...
|
In das Form CATIA V5 Programmierung wechseln |